police arrest driver who plowed through pedestrians in central Trier, Germany

The moment police arrested a car driver who sped though a pedestrian area in the German town of Trier, killing at least two people and injuring several others, has been allegedly caught on video and shared online.

The clip circulating on social media appears to show three officers pinning the suspect to the ground and handcuffing him as several others secure the perimeter.

Leave a Reply

Your email address will not be published. Required fields are marked *